1. Introduction to URL Shortening
URL shortening is a technique on the net where an extended URL can be converted right into a shorter, a lot more manageable variety. This shortened URL redirects to the original extensive URL when visited. Services like Bitly and TinyURL are very well-acknowledged samples of URL shorteners. The need for URL shortening arose with the advent of social media marketing platforms like Twitter, the place character limits for posts built it tough to share extended URLs.

Outside of social media, URL shorteners are beneficial in internet marketing strategies, emails, and printed media in which prolonged URLs could be cumbersome.

2. Core Components of the URL Shortener
A URL shortener typically includes the next parts:

World-wide-web Interface: Here is the front-stop element the place users can enter their lengthy URLs and receive shortened versions. It might be a simple form with a Web content.
Database: A database is necessary to retail store the mapping involving the initial extended URL as well as shortened Model. Databases like MySQL, PostgreSQL, or NoSQL choices like MongoDB may be used.
Redirection Logic: This is the backend logic that usually takes the shorter URL and redirects the person to your corresponding very long URL. This logic will likely be implemented in the web server or an application layer.
API: Several URL shorteners offer an API to make sure that third-party apps can programmatically shorten URLs and retrieve the original prolonged URLs.
3. Designing the URL Shortening Algorithm
The crux of the URL shortener lies in its algorithm for changing a lengthy URL into a short 1. Quite a few procedures might be utilized, such as:

Hashing: The long URL could be hashed into a fixed-dimension string, which serves because the shorter URL. On the other hand, hash collisions (diverse URLs leading to the same hash) should be managed.
Base62 Encoding: One particular widespread technique is to utilize Base62 encoding (which makes use of 62 figures: 0-9, A-Z, and a-z) on an integer ID. The ID corresponds to your entry in the database. This process makes certain that the quick URL is as shorter as you can.
Random String Era: One more solution is always to crank out a random string of a hard and fast length (e.g., six characters) and check if it’s by now in use inside the database. Otherwise, it’s assigned towards the prolonged URL.
four. Databases Management
The databases schema to get a URL shortener is normally straightforward, with two primary fields:

ID: A unique identifier for every URL entry.
Lengthy URL: The initial URL that should be shortened.
Brief URL/Slug: The shorter Variation in the URL, frequently stored as a unique string.
In combination with these, you might like to keep metadata like the creation date, expiration day, and the amount of instances the limited URL has actually been accessed.

five. Handling Redirection
Redirection is actually a significant Component of the URL shortener's operation. Any time a consumer clicks on a brief URL, the provider needs to immediately retrieve the first URL through the databases and redirect the person applying an HTTP 301 (everlasting redirect) or 302 (temporary redirect) status code.

Effectiveness is vital below, as the process should be just about instantaneous. Strategies like databases indexing and caching (e.g., utilizing Redis or Memcached) is often used to speed up the retrieval system.

6. Stability Issues
Stability is a substantial worry in URL shorteners:

Destructive URLs: A URL shortener could be abused to unfold destructive links. Employing URL validation, blacklisting, or integrating with 3rd-bash security services to examine URLs before shortening them can mitigate this chance.
Spam Avoidance: Price limiting and CAPTCHA can protect against abuse by spammers trying to produce 1000s of shorter URLs.
seven. Scalability
As the URL shortener grows, it might need to handle numerous URLs and redirect requests. This needs a scalable architecture, quite possibly involving load balancers, dispersed databases, and microservices.

Load Balancing: Distribute targeted visitors throughout multiple servers to handle high hundreds.
Distributed Databases: Use databases that could scale horizontally, like Cassandra or MongoDB.
Microservices: Individual problems like URL shortening, analytics, and redirection into diverse companies to enhance scalability and maintainability.
8. Analytics
URL shorteners often provide analytics to trace how frequently a brief URL is clicked, wherever the visitors is coming from, and other practical metrics. This involves logging Just about every redirect And perhaps integrating with analytics platforms.
